In May, the average temperature in Flat Rock, United States hovers around 14°C (58°F). Expect a minimum of 0°C (32°F) and a pleasant maximum of 27°C (81°F). Throughout the month, 121 mm (4.8 in) of precipitation is expected over 14 days, with an average humidity level of 81%. Prepare for a mix of chilly and warm days, perfect for layering!

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.

How May Weather in Flat Rock Compares to Other Months

Weather in Flat Rock var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ares May’s weather to other months in Flat Rock,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Flat Rock, showing how May’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-2°C (29°F)85 mm (3.3 inches)88%low
February Weather-1°C (30°F)83 mm (3.3 inches)87%moderate
March Weather2°C (37°F)88 mm (3.5 inches)87%moderate
April Weather7°C (46°F)101 mm (4.0 inches)87%very high
May Weather14°C (58°F)121 mm (4.8 inches)81%very high
June Weather21°C (69°F)83 mm (3.3 inches)82%very high
July Weather24°C (75°F)96 mm (3.8 inches)81%very high
August Weather23°C (74°F)80 mm (3.2 inches)78%very high
September Weather20°C (68°F)68 mm (2.7 inches)78%very high
October Weather13°C (57°F)118 mm (4.6 inches)82%high
November Weather5°C (41°F)102 mm (4.0 inches)89%moderate
December Weather1°C (34°F)74 mm (2.9 inches)86%low
